2. Does Interstate have a trusted reputation in Northern Virginia?  

Interstate has over 80 years of experience in the moving industry within the Greater DC area, and they have developed a trusted presence both in the NVAR region and beyond. Interstate only moves with fully trained packers and loaders, ensuring that there will not be any crews who are learning on the job, protecting all items that are being moved. 

Interstate started locally in 1943, and the same family (now the third generation) runs the business. In the 1970s, Interstate moved headquarters from Southwest D.C., out to Springfield.

3.  What is the scope of Interstate's Residential Moving services?

In addition to assisting with local moves, Interstate also moves clients outside of the D.C. area, across the United States and around the world. They can provide both short and long-term storage. They also move people into the greater metro area,

4. What storage options does Interstate Provide? 

Sherry pointed out that Interstate has a one-of-a-kind, special decluttering program. They provide short term storage for items that Realtors® would prefer to have out of the house, in order for the house to sell quicker and for a higher value. 

Storage has become more popular in this market, as many people are not moving directly from House A to House B. While clients are waiting on the house to be available, they can store items with Interstate. *Interstate is currently offering up to one-month free storage for clients experiencing this, please contact Sherry for more information.

Sherry also emphasized that occasionally, there will be a client who has to move out of the area on a special job assignment, perhaps resulting in them being out of country for a year or two. Interstate can work with clients to store items safety and securely during this time span.

5.  What separates Interstate from other moving companies?

First and foremost, Interstate conducts a visual survey, available in-person or virtually, so their professionals can assess what is going to be moved, first-hand, and then provide clients with the most accurate estimate for the move. 

Additionally, as mentioned earlier, Interstate moving crews do not learn on the job. There is a training system in place to ensure movers are fully ready before hitting the field. Without this, clients can have extra costs that results from damaged items, and it also takes more time to move items if people are being trained on the job.

Sherry noted the longevity and trusted reputation of Interstate, in addition to their investments made to the local, Northern Virginia community. Interstate offers trucks for many charities, including Wreaths Across America. When working with Wreaths Across America, Interstate transports thousands of wreaths to multiple national cemeteries across the country, including Arlington. Sherry also noted Interstate's work with Afghan refugees.
